Output 95da30624be45b99a1da1981f28b58df2aa9f79a7d0447ef0d39d4e1936980c1:0

value
18900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edde9c16bc4fef9e2f8a09ad3abadde9bf866008 OP_EQUAL
address
MVau466RJPkXZkX27CSS3u1g13LHUseWFQ
transaction
95da30624be45b99a1da1981f28b58df2aa9f79a7d0447ef0d39d4e1936980c1
spent
true